摘要:
本文將詳細(xì)介紹app開發(fā)與測試的相關(guān)內(nèi)容,引出讀者的興趣,并提供相關(guān)背景信息。
正文:
1、app開發(fā)指的是為移動(dòng)設(shè)備(如智能手機(jī)、平板電腦等)開發(fā)應(yīng)用程序的過程。隨著移動(dòng)設(shè)備的普及和用戶對app的需求不斷增加,app開發(fā)成為了一個(gè)熱門領(lǐng)域。
2、在app開發(fā)過程中,開發(fā)者需要綜合考慮用戶體驗(yàn)、功能需求和平臺(tái)適應(yīng)性等因素。為了保證app的質(zhì)量,開發(fā)者需要進(jìn)行測試,以確保app的穩(wěn)定性和安全性。
3、app開發(fā)可以利用各種開發(fā)工具和技術(shù),如Xcode、Android Studio等。開發(fā)者需要掌握一種或多種編程語言,如Java、Swift等。
1、app測試是確保app質(zhì)量的關(guān)鍵步驟。通過測試,開發(fā)者可以發(fā)現(xiàn)和修復(fù)缺陷,提升app的穩(wěn)定性和性能。
2、在測試過程中,開發(fā)者需要測試app的各項(xiàng)功能,并模擬用戶的實(shí)際使用場景。通過測試,可以發(fā)現(xiàn)潛在問題,并采取相應(yīng)的措施進(jìn)行修復(fù)。
3、測試涵蓋了很多方面,包括功能測試、性能測試、兼容性測試等。通過多種測試手段的綜合運(yùn)用,可以全面評(píng)估app的質(zhì)量。
1、不同移動(dòng)設(shè)備和操作系統(tǒng)的多樣性增加了app開發(fā)與測試的復(fù)雜性。開發(fā)者需要考慮各種設(shè)備和操作系統(tǒng)的兼容性。
2、用戶對app的期望不斷提高,對于穩(wěn)定性和性能的要求也越來越高。開發(fā)者需要在緊張的時(shí)間表下進(jìn)行開發(fā)和測試,確保app在發(fā)布前達(dá)到用戶的期望。
3、快速迭代的開發(fā)模式使得開發(fā)和測試的工作更加緊密和并行化。開發(fā)者需要不斷進(jìn)行版本迭代和測試,以應(yīng)對市場和用戶的需求。
1、在app開發(fā)過程中,開發(fā)者應(yīng)該遵循良好的編碼規(guī)范和開發(fā)流程,減少潛在的缺陷和問題。
2、開發(fā)者應(yīng)該使用各種測試工具和技術(shù),包括自動(dòng)化測試、性能測試等,以提高測試的效率和準(zhǔn)確性。
3、持續(xù)集成和持續(xù)交付是現(xiàn)代app開發(fā)和測試的趨勢。開發(fā)者應(yīng)該采用這些方法,實(shí)現(xiàn)快速迭代和持續(xù)改進(jìn)。
結(jié)論:
通過本文的闡述,我們了解了app開發(fā)與測試的重要性和挑戰(zhàn)。在不斷發(fā)展的移動(dòng)設(shè)備市場中,合理的開發(fā)和測試方法對于開發(fā)者來說至關(guān)重要。只有通過精心的開發(fā)和全面的測試,才能保障app的質(zhì)量,滿足用戶的需求。因此,我們呼吁開發(fā)者和測試人員應(yīng)該不斷學(xué)習(xí)和掌握最新的開發(fā)和測試技術(shù),以應(yīng)對快速變化的市場需求,并為用戶提供優(yōu)秀的移動(dòng)應(yīng)用體驗(yàn)。